Individual Giving Manager

Job Description

Full Time, Fixed Term 12 Months (Maternity Cover)This role can be based at either Boston Spa or St Pancras Opportunities for hybrid home/onsite working The British Library is home to a world of discovery for researchers, writers, thinkers, artists, creativesand scientists alike. We have over 170 million items in our collection, from Magna Carta and Shakespeares first folio, to Beatles lyrics and Angela Carters archive. Our philanthropic supporters help us open up this world of ideas and inspiration for everyone.Their support enables us to share our collection as widely as possible by developing learning programmes for young people, supporting growing businesses, inspiring diverse communities, broadening our exhibitions and events and improving our physical spaces.TheLibrary is in the quiet phase of an ambitious multimillion pound fundraising campaign. Working as part of a dedicated and ambitious development team, the Individual Giving Manager will make a significant contribution to team targets, with a particular remitto expand the Librarys individual giving prospect pipeline, building relationships and devising creative strategies to unlock the potential of the Librarys Patrons programme, both nationally and internationally. Youll also line manage the Individual GivingOfficer and work closely together to build the Librarys lower value giving programmes, direct marketing, onsite giving and appeals. Managing your own portfolio, you will also have responsibility for the cultivation and stewardship of donors towards the Libraryslegacy giving programme.You will have significant experience of individual giving, and a proven track record of success in running successful regular giving programmes. You will also have experience of managing your own portfolio of donors, planning successfulstewardship and cultivation programmes (including a varied and busy calendar of events) and skills in managing a donor or customer database (the Library uses Raisers Edge). You will be able to work on your own initiative, pro-actively identifying fundraisingopportunities to meet the teams stretching annual targets. A collaborative, determined, open and honest approach to align with the Librarys values and purposes will also be vital. As one of the worlds great libraries, our duty is to preserve the nationsintellectual memory for the future and make it available to all for research, inspiration and enjoyment. At present we have well over 170 million items, in most known languages, with three million new items added every year. We have manuscripts, maps, newspapers,magazines, prints and drawings, music scores, and patents. We make our collections and programmes available to all. We operate the worlds largest document delivery service providing millions of items a year to customers all over the world. What matters tous is that we preserve the national memory and enable knowledge to be created both now and in the future by anyone, anywhere. In return we offer a competitive salary and a number of excellent benefits. Our pension scheme is one of the most valuable benefitswe offer, as our staff can become members of the Alpha Pension Scheme where the Library contributes a minimum of 20.6% (this may be higher dependant on grade. Another significant benefit the Library provides is the provision of a flexible working hours schemewhich could allow you to work your hours flexibly over the week and to take up to 5 days flexi leave in a 3 month period. This is on top of 25 days holiday from entry and public and privilege holidays.For further information and to apply, please visit theBritish Library Website, job reference :03829Closing Date: 31 October 2021Interview Date: week commencing 8 November 2021
